第二次个人编程作业:代码互改
博客班级 | https://edu.cnblogs.com/campus/fzzcxy/2018SE1/ |
---|---|
作业要求 | https://edu.cnblogs.com/campus/fzzcxy/2018SE1/homework/11195 |
作业目标 | <查看他人的代码,并给出相应的建议;根据别人给的建议,修改自己的代码> |
作业源代码 | https://gitee.com/li-wenlin/personal |
学号 | <211806323> |
“让我看看你的代码!”
詹泽浩的代码:(代码地址)出现的问题:代码过于繁琐,提取分数核心代码几乎相同 issue:
林泽龙的代码:(代码地址)
出现的问题:文件路径应改为相对路径,绝对路径找不到文件。
issue:
胡玉彬的代码:(代码地址)
出现的问题:代码过于繁琐,提取分数核心代码几乎相同
issue:
张春琳的代码:(代码地址)
出现的问题:文件路径应改为相对路径,绝对路径会报错。
issue:
“容我再改一改!”
1.根据陈颖鹏的issue:需要修改输出问题的时候不要太死板。 2.增加注释,提升阅读的便捷性
3.代码重复率比较高:虽然我知道代码重复率比较高,但是我不知道如何简化它。
“让我再看一看!”
我暂时还没有看到相应的代码修改回复。总结:
1、自己没有考虑到使用绝对路径会产生的问题。2、心得:通过这次作业,我知道了在代码里找错误和不足也是件很重要的事情,很多题目不是做出来了就结束了,
而是要用更好的方法去解决,去优化才对。不仅限于完成功能的实现,还需代码的优化。
3、在写代码的时候需要适当的添加注释,以便以自己以后的修改,和别人的阅读,增加代码的可读性。